Anbernic RG556
Large-screen Android value

~$250
MSRP updated Dec 2025
- 5.48" AMOLED
- Unisoc T820
- Hall effect sticks
Best for
Where this handheld shines the most.
- Large screen for emulation
- Good middle-ground performance
- Hall effect sticks for longevity
Watch outs
Tradeoffs to know before buying.
- Processor is mid-range
- Some demanding games may struggle
- Less community support than Retroid
